Netflix actually caved and paid comcast to get better speeds ("interconnects").

It wasn't the bad PR that forced the issue.

https://arstechnica.com/information-technology/2014/02/netfl...

Speeds increased 65% after the payment. It was kind of a big deal at the time, since most of the time nobody paid for this. "Netflix has struck payment-free deals with Frontier, British Telecom, TDC, Clearwire, GVT, Telus, Bell Canada, Virgin, Cablevision, Google Fiber, Telmex, and RCN"
